Data Exploration for Swift and other N-body simulation
This is a project that was started back in 2001 to help data analysis for a revision of Hal Levison's Swift planetary simulation framework. SwiftVis is a data exploration and visualization package written in Java that has a GUI which supports the creation of visual "dataflow programs" and can be used by non-programmers.

A fair attempt at the Keplerian tradition to explore the solar system
Nowadays the idea of a music of the spheres, or a cosmic music that descends from the planets seems more like poetic philosophy than anything scientific. However, when the scientist Kepler discovered special principles about planetary motion, he also reconsidered the music. Apparently his observance of a harmonic law of planetary motion was reason for him to propose a computable system of pitch and harmony deriving from angular velocity.
The purpose of the programming project is as a tool to examine his system. With Java 2, it provides an open-source solution for listening to harmonies so generated by planetary motion. ...

Universe, an astronomical class library written in Java. Support for planetary calculations, sky object catalog management, sky mapping, and telescope control is provided.
Java library to calculate heliocentric and geocentric planetary positions. Two types of calculations are supported: a 'fast' version which has an accuracy of about 1 arc second and a 'full' version that implements the full VSOP87 theory.
Port of Astrolog and/or Astrolog32 to Java. Astrolog is a free astrology software program since 1991. Astrolog can create horoscopes, natal charts, and calculate current planetary positions in sidereal, traditional, and heliocentric formats.

JPARSEC is a Java Package of Astronomical Resources for Standard Ephemerides Calculations, focused on accuracy, documentation, 2D/3D charts, realistic planetary rendering, and Astrophysical modeling. For source code visit http://conga.oan.es/~alonso/
Planetary Scale Event Propagation and Router ("PsEPR" pronounced "pepper") is an experimental status and notification service. Pub/sub system for exchange of XML messages creating an event service for PlanetLab (http://www.planet-lab.org/).
The Virtual Laboratory for Earth and Planetary Materials (VLab) collaborative GRID-based environment. Concentrating on scientific computation workflows and auto-generation of visualization services. http://vlab.msi.umn.edu
